Each tile pick alters the chance landscape for subsequent picks. With 25 squares typical on most boards, choosing one hazard creates a 4% likelihood of immediate defeat on the opening pick, while 24 dangers flip this to a 96% loss probability. The quantitative elegance lies in how rates compensate for increased danger, producing mathematically comparable anticipated amounts across risk levels when played optimally.
Computing Your Real Probabilities
- Identify Overall Cells: Identify the board dimensions (generally 25 cells in standard setup)
- Subtract Dangers: Calculate safe tiles by subtracting your selected mine number from complete cells
- Apply Successive Likelihood: Each successful pick lowers both clear squares and total remaining tiles by one
- Calculate Victory Probabilities: Compound single likelihoods throughout planned choices to assess round completion chance
- Contrast Versus Multiplier: Judge whether the given reward justifies the determined risk
Bankroll Control Methods for Savvy Gamers
Successful fund control divides casual users from dedicated experts. Our platform provides options for personal restrictions, however strategic users apply additional protections. This volatility built-in in our system means prolonged negative sequences occur even with good approach, rendering backup money crucial for ongoing play.
The idea of “depletion likelihood”—the probability of draining your funds before achieving your target—grows particularly relevant in high-variance games. Safe users typically risk no more than 1-2% of their total bankroll per game, while risky approaches may extend to 5%. These figures immediately relate with survival likelihood across hundreds of betting rounds.
